NWS Forecaster Discussion
141 fxus61 kpbz 052136 aaa afdpbz Area forecast discussion...updated National Weather Service Pittsburgh PA 536 PM EDT Sat Jul 5 2008 Synopsis... a weak area of low pressure aloft will bring a chance of afternoon and evening showers and thunderstorms mainly along the higher elevations east of Pittsburgh through Sunday. A dry and warmer day for Monday will give way to a chance of showers and storms Tuesday as a front approaches. && Near term /through Sunday/... have updated to remove all mention of pcp except for southeast ridges. Also lowered cloud cover as skies clearing as sun angle lowers. Weak upper low over the Ohio Valley will slowly open and edge east through Monday. Scattered showers and storms on front side of this low this evening and again Sunday afternoon mainly south and east of Pittsburgh. Low begins to lift out with heights rising for a warmer day Sunday. && Short term /Sunday night through Tuesday/... leftover diurnal showers Sunday evening otherwise dry weather expected through Monday. Southwest flow at the surface and rising heights aloft will push temperatures above normal with humid conditions. Front will approach form Great Lakes during Tuesday with scattered showers and storms especially in the afternoon. && Long term /Tuesday night through Saturday/... cold front drops into southern Great Lakes Tuesday night and across County Warning Area on Wednesday with chance of thunderstorms late Tuesday night in northern zones and across entire County Warning Area Wednesday. Surface high pressure builds into region on on Thursday with partly cloudy skies and at or slightly below normal temperatures. Upper level ridge begins to build into eastern United States on Friday and remains in place through the weekend bringing partly to mostly sunny skies...above normal temperatures and increasing humidity. && Aviation /22z Saturday through Thursday/... isolated thunderstorms possible in northern WV until 00z.
